New York Activates Code Blue Due to Extreme Cold – NBC New York

NEW YORK — The New York City Office of Emergency Management activated Code Blue due to extreme cold. Code Blue goes into effect when temperatures drop to 32 degrees Fahrenheit or below, according to estimates from the National Weather Service.
